Just what is a Robotic Vacuum Cleaner?
A robotic vacuum cleaner is an autonomous gadget created to tidy floorings without direct human control. These compact, normally disc-shaped machines navigate your home using a combination of sensors, mapping innovation, and algorithms. They are engineered to suck up dust, dirt, pet hair, and debris from different floor surfaces like wood, tile, and carpets.
Robovacs operate on rechargeable batteries and generally featured a charging dock. As soon as their battery is low or cleaning is complete (depending on the design and settings), they immediately return to their charging dock. Lots of modern-day robovacs are also Wi-Fi enabled, enabling users to control them remotely via smartphone apps. This connection opens up a realm of functions like scheduling cleaning sessions, setting virtual boundaries, and even keeping an eye on cleaning progress from afar.
Unloading the Technology: How Robovacs Navigate and Clean
The intelligence of a robovac depends on its advanced innovation that allows it to navigate and tidy effectively. Here are some crucial elements and technologies powering these cleaning robots:
Navigation Systems: Robovacs use various navigation approaches to map and traverse your home.
Random Bounce: Simpler and frequently older models utilize a random bounce method. They move in an approximately straight line until they come across a barrier, then change direction. While less effective, they eventually cover most locations.Gyro Navigation: These robovacs use gyroscopes to keep a straight cleaning course and remember where they have cleaned. This is more organized than random bounce.Camera-Based SLAM (Simultaneous Localization and Mapping): More advanced models use cams to “see” their surroundings. SLAM innovation enables them to develop a comprehensive map of your home in real-time, allowing more effective and methodical navigation.LiDAR (Light Detection and Ranging): Similar to self-driving automobiles, some premium robovacs use LiDAR. This innovation discharges laser pulses to determine ranges and develop extremely accurate maps, even in low-light conditions.
Sensing units: A variety of sensing units are essential for robovac operation:
Bump Sensors: Detect accidents with walls and furniture, prompting the robovac to alter instructions.Cliff Sensors: Prevent the robovac from falling down stairs or ledges.Wall Follow Sensors: Enable the robovac to clean edges and baseboards successfully.Dirt Detect Sensors: Some robovacs have sensing units that discover areas with higher concentrations of dirt, prompting them to focus cleaning on those areas.
Cleaning Mechanisms: Robovacs use a combination of brushes and suction to clean:
Side Brushes: Rotate outwards to sweep particles from edges and corners into the course of the primary brush.Main Brush Rollers: Typically located underneath the robovac, these rollers agitate carpets and sweep particles towards the suction nozzle. Some models have actually brush rollers developed for specific floor types (e.g., softer brushes for hardwood, stiffer for carpets).Suction: A motor produces suction to pull debris into the dustbin. Suction power differs between designs.
Smart Features and Connectivity: Modern robovacs often boast smart functions:
App Control: Enables remote control, scheduling, zone cleaning, virtual boundaries, and cleaning history viewing.Voice Control Integration: Compatibility with voice assistants like Amazon Alexa or Google Assistant for hands-free control.Mapping and Zone Cleaning: Allows users to define specific areas for cleaning or to produce “no-go zones” by means of the app.Multi-Floor Mapping: Advanced robovacs can save maps of several floors, perfect for multi-story homes.
The Perks of Owning a Robovac Hoover
The appeal of robovac hoovers is undeniable. They use many advantages that contribute to a cleaner and more hassle-free way of life:
Hands-Free Cleaning: The most substantial advantage is automation. Robovacs tidy floors independently, maximizing your time for other tasks or leisure activities.Constant Cleaning: Robovacs can be set up to clean routinely, ensuring a constant level of tidiness in your home, even if you do not have time for everyday handbook vacuuming.Reach Under Furniture: Their low profile enables them to clean up under beds, sofas, and other furnishings where standard vacuums battle to reach.Ideal for Pet Owners: Robovacs are excellent at getting pet hair, a continuous difficulty for lots of households with furry buddies. Regular robovac cleaning can considerably minimize pet hair accumulation.Convenience for Busy Individuals and Families: For busy experts, parents, or anyone who values time, robovacs use a substantial time-saving solution for floor cleaning.Improved Air Quality (with HEPA Filters): Many robovacs come equipped with HEPA filters, which trap fine dust particles, allergens, and pet dander, contributing to improved indoor air quality, especially advantageous for allergic reaction victims.
Choosing the Right Robovac for Your Needs
With a broad array of robovac designs offered, picking the right one can seem overwhelming. Think about these factors when making your choice:
Home Size and Layout: Larger homes or homes with several spaces may benefit from robovacs with sophisticated mapping and longer battery life. Complex designs with numerous barriers might demand models with exceptional navigation.Floor Types: Assess the dominant floor key ins your home. Some robovacs are better fit for hardwood floorings, while others excel on carpets. Search for models with functions enhanced for your particular floor types.Pet Ownership: If you have family pets, prioritize robovacs with strong suction, tangle-free brush rollers designed for pet hair, and bigger dustbins.Spending plan: Robovacs range in rate from affordable to high-end. Determine your spending plan and prioritize features that are most crucial to you within that range.Desired Features: Consider which features are must-haves for you. Do you require app control, voice integration, mapping, zone cleaning, or multi-floor mapping?Noise Level: Robovacs vary in sound output. If sound sensitivity is a concern, look for models marketed as quieter.Dustbin Capacity: Larger dustbins need less frequent emptying, which can be practical, specifically for bigger homes or homes with animals.

Preserving Your Robovac for Longevity
To guarantee your robovac hoover continues to carry out efficiently and lasts for many years to come, regular maintenance is necessary:
Empty the Dustbin Regularly: This is vital. A full dustbin lowers suction power and cleaning effectiveness. Empty it after each cleaning cycle or as needed.Clean the Brushes: Pet hair and debris can tangle in the brushes. Routinely get rid of and clean up the primary brush roller and side brushes.Clean the Sensors: Wipe the sensors, particularly cliff sensors and wall follow sensors, with a soft, dry fabric to ensure they work properly.Change Filters: HEPA filters ought to be changed periodically according to the manufacturer’s recommendations to keep optimal air filtration.Inspect and Clean Wheels: Ensure the wheels are devoid of debris and turn smoothly.Software Updates: If your robovac has Wi-Fi connectivity, guarantee you install any available software updates to gain from efficiency enhancements and new functions.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s) about Robovac Hoovers
Q1: Are robovacs as effective as routine vacuum?A1: While robovacs have actually become increasingly powerful, the majority of are not as powerful as full-sized upright vacuums. They are designed for day-to-day upkeep cleaning and are excellent at getting daily dust, dirt, and pet hair. For deep cleaning or extremely greatly soiled locations, a standard vacuum may still be essential.
Q2: Can robovacs clean carpets effectively?A2: Yes, lots of robovacs are created to tidy carpets. Try to find models with features like strong suction, brush rollers designed for carpets, and adjustable suction levels. However, for thick pile carpets, higher-end models might be needed for optimal cleaning.
Q3: Do robovacs work well with pet hair?A3: Yes, robovacs are typically extremely effective at getting pet hair. Try to find models specifically advertised as pet-friendly, often including tangle-free brush rollers and strong suction. Routine robovac cleaning can significantly decrease pet hair build-up.
Q4: How long do robovac batteries last?A4: Battery life differs depending on the design and cleaning mode. The majority of robovacs provide battery life varying from 60 to 120 minutes on a single charge. Some high-end designs can run for even longer.
Q5: Can robovacs harm furnishings?A5: Robovacs are developed to navigate around furnishings utilizing bump sensors. While they might gently run into furnishings, they are not designed to cause damage. However, it’s a good idea to clear any loose or vulnerable items from the floor before running a robovac.
Q6: How frequently should I run my robovac?A6: For ideal tidiness, running your robovac everyday or every other day is recommended, especially in homes with animals or high traffic. You can set up cleaning sessions through the app for automated cleaning.
Q7: Do robovacs operate in the dark?A7: Models with LiDAR navigation work successfully in the dark as they utilize lasers for mapping. Camera-based SLAM models might perform less efficiently in very dark environments. Random bounce and gyro navigation models typically function well in most lighting conditions as they count on physical sensors.
Q8: What happens if my robovac gets stuck?A8: Most modern-day robovacs are created to prevent getting stuck. Nevertheless, if they do get stuck, they typically stop and issue a mistake notice (sometimes through the app). You’ll require to by hand complimentary it. Clearing mess and wires from the floor can lessen the possibilities of getting stuck.
Q9: Can robovacs climb over limits?A9: Most robovacs can climb over limits, however the height they can manage varies. Usually, they can deal with limits approximately 0.5-0.75 inches. Check the manufacturer’s specs for the limit climbing capability of a specific design.
Q10: Are robovacs noisy?A10: Robovac noise levels differ depending on the design and suction power. Typically, they are quieter than standard vacuum cleaners, however they still produce some sound. Try to find designs promoted as “peaceful operation” if noise is a concern.
